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— Sentinel outperforms the cheaper NSX GAMING on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ck!
Advantages of Sentinel Gaming Desktop PC
- Performs up to 16% better in Elden Ring than NSX GAMING - 87 vs 75 FPS
- Up to 9% better value when playing Elden Ring than NSX GAMING - $13.22 vs $14.52 per FPS
Advantages of NSX GAMING PC
- Up to 5% cheaper than Sentinel - $1089.0 vs $1149.99
